Saturday, Aug. 15
Who wants some ice cream? The Washington County Historical Society will host their annual Ice Cream Social Saturday at Headquarters House (118 E. Dickson St.). There will be ice cream (duh), cake, and live music by East of Zion and Walter Schmidt & Arkansas Chowder. Admission’s $5 for adults and $2.50 for kids. All the details are here.
Fayetteville funk-rockers Groovement will celebrate the release of their new album, Clouds Saturday night at George’s. Henry + The Invisibles and Branjae. The cover is $10, and the first 100 people through the door will get a free copy of the new album.
Also in music, Little Rock band Bombay Harambee will be back in town for a show at Backspace with Pagiins, and Dana Louise & The Glorious Birds will be back at Kingfish Saturday night as well.

Sunday events, Aug. 16, 2015
The annual Razorback Football Fan Day celebration is set for Sunday afternoon at Razorback Stadium. Gates open at 2 p.m., and Razorback players will be on the field signing autographs. More details about the event are here.
The Offshoot Film Festival will announce the lineup for their 2015 event Sunday night at Fresco Restaurant & Cocktails. The party starts at 6:30 p.m.
Also Sunday night, Maxine’s Tap Room will host another version of their Singled Out show featuring local band, Block Street Hot Club. It starts at 7 p.m., and there’s no cover.
